在数字化时代,一个简洁、美观且易用的网页界面对于提升用户体验至关重要。支付宝作为中国领先的移动支付平台,其网页界面设计深受用户喜爱。本文将揭秘HTML5网页界面设计与实战技巧,帮助您打造出支付宝风格的网页。
一、界面设计原则
1. 用户体验至上
在设计界面时,始终将用户体验放在首位。确保用户能够轻松地找到所需功能,并快速完成任务。
2. 简洁明了
界面应保持简洁,避免过多的装饰和动画,以免分散用户注意力。遵循“少即是多”的原则,让用户在第一时间抓住重点。
3. 一致性
保持界面元素的一致性,包括颜色、字体、布局等。这有助于用户快速适应,并提升整体的美感。
4. 可访问性
确保网页界面满足不同用户的需求,包括色盲、视力不佳等。遵循WAI-ARIA(Web Accessibility Initiative - Accessible Rich Internet Applications)标准,提高网页的可访问性。
二、HTML5技术选型
1. HTML5
作为现代网页开发的核心技术,HTML5提供了丰富的标签和属性,有助于构建更强大的网页界面。
2. CSS3
CSS3提供了丰富的样式和动画效果,可以帮助您打造美观且富有动感的界面。
3. JavaScript
JavaScript是实现交互效果的关键技术,可以让您的网页更具活力。
三、实战技巧
1. 网页布局
采用响应式设计,确保网页在不同设备上均能呈现最佳效果。可以使用Flexbox或Grid布局实现复杂布局。
<!DOCTYPE html>
<html>
<head>
<title>响应式布局示例</title>
<meta name="viewport" content="width=device-width, initial-scale=1.0">
<style>
.container {
display: flex;
flex-wrap: wrap;
justify-content: space-around;
}
.item {
flex: 1 1 300px;
margin: 10px;
background-color: #f4f4f4;
padding: 20px;
box-sizing: border-box;
}
</style>
</head>
<body>
<div class="container">
<div class="item">Item 1</div>
<div class="item">Item 2</div>
<div class="item">Item 3</div>
<div class="item">Item 4</div>
<div class="item">Item 5</div>
<div class="item">Item 6</div>
</div>
</body>
</html>
2. 网页样式
使用CSS3实现样式设计,包括颜色、字体、阴影、渐变等。以下是一个示例:
body {
background-color: #f8f8f8;
font-family: 'Arial', sans-serif;
}
header {
background-color: #007aff;
color: #fff;
padding: 10px 20px;
text-align: center;
}
3. 网页交互
使用JavaScript实现网页交互,如按钮点击、表单验证等。以下是一个示例:
<!DOCTYPE html>
<html>
<head>
<title>JavaScript交互示例</title>
</head>
<body>
<input type="text" id="username" placeholder="请输入用户名">
<button onclick="validate()">验证</button>
<script>
function validate() {
var username = document.getElementById('username').value;
if (username.length < 6) {
alert('用户名长度不能小于6位!');
}
}
</script>
</body>
</html>
四、总结
通过以上技巧,您可以为您的网页打造出支付宝风格的界面。记住,界面设计是一个持续迭代的过程,不断优化和改进,以提升用户体验。祝您设计出令人惊叹的网页界面!
